> Once SentryHMSNotification table is not empty, there are two cases when a full snapshot is triggered.
> # If first event in list of notifications received from HMS greater than latest sentry hms notification Id
> # If latest sentry notification Id is greater than current hms notification Id
> The later is a unexpected case where for some reason sentry gets ahead of HMS. We should add a logic to trigger a full snapshot in case 2 only after a configurable number of retries. This will avoid  unnecessary full snapshot triggers as they are resource intensive
